<br /> #38 Approved/Sufficient Ventilation and Lighting
<br /> OBSERVATIONS:Cover for ceiling lights at kitchen lacking. Provide shatterproof cover in 2 weeks. This is a repeat
<br /> violation.
<br /> CALCODE DESCRIPTION:Exhaust hoods shall be provided to remove toxic gases,heat,grease, vapors and smoke and be approved by
<br /> the local building department. Canopy-type hoods shall extend 6"beyond all cooking equipment.All areas shall have sufficient ventilation
<br /> to facilitate proper food storage. Toilet rooms shall be vented to the outside air by a screened openable window,an air shaft, or a
<br /> light-switch activated exhaust fan,consistent with local building codes. (114149, 114149.1)Adequate lighting shall be provided in all areas
<br /> to facilitate cleaning and inspection.Light fixtures in areas where open food is stored,served,prepared,and where utensils are washed
<br /> shall be of shatterproof construction or protected with light shields. (114149.2, 114149.3, 114252, 114252.1)
<br /> #40 Proper Use and Storage of Wiping Cloths
<br /> OBSERVATIONS:Multiple wipe cloths inside and outside kitchen not sanitizer bucket. Store in 100 ppm chlorine or 200
<br /> ppm quat. This is a repeat violation.
<br /> CALCODE DESCRIPTION:Wiping cloths used to wipe service counters,scales or other surfaces that may come into contact with food
<br /> shall be used only once unless kept in clean water with sanitizer. (114135, 114185.1 114185.3(d-e))
